Bill Summary
To ensure benefits through enhanced Selective Service registration
AI Summary
This bill aims to ensure benefits through enhanced Selective Service registration. It proposes to amend Massachusetts state law to require the Registrar of Motor Vehicles to automatically register eligible applicants for driver's licenses, permits, and identification cards with the Selective Service System, unless the applicant explicitly declines. The bill also requires the Registrar to notify applicants of their federal duty to register with Selective Service and the consequences of failing to do so. Implementation of this bill is contingent on the Registrar receiving sufficient federal funds to cover the initial start-up costs for the necessary computer programming changes.
